The game appears to strongly prefer to target ranged dps/healers over melee with certain raid boss abilities. This creates an unfair/unfun situation when there are only a couple of ranged in the raid as they can and will get targeted repeatedly.
Is the code assuming a certain ratio of ranged vs dps? If so, it needs to be better about boundary conditions. You know we all aren’t in Limit or Echoes right? Some guilds have to take what they can get as far as players/classes go and that can result in a raid like what I was in the other night.
We killed Heroic Sire but our raid was really unbalanced in that, out of a raid of 18 people, we only had 4 ranged. We had a warlock (myself), a boomkin, a resto druid and a holy priest. Our other healers were holy paladins and so the game considers them melee.
The result? I was constantly selected by the boss for abilities. On the kill, out of 7 waves of fatal finesse casts, he targeted me all 7 times (which meant for two different periods I had 2 stacks - I thankfully missed getting 3 stacked by one second). I took 365k of unavoidable damage just from fatal finesse.
If I look at all the wipes + kill I see that for Night Hunter I was targeted 15 times. The boomkin got 8, the resto druid 13 and the holy priest 8. The melee averaged 2.75 with a high of 5. Night Hunter was targeting me 5 times more often than the average dps character in our raid.
